Lithium Iron Phosphate Battery

The lithium iron phosphate battery (LiFePO4 battery) or LFP battery (lithium ferrophosphate) is a type of lithium-ion battery using lithium iron phosphate (LiFePO4) as the cathode material, and a graphitic carbon electrode with a metallic backing as the anode. 3.2V 280Ah LiFePO4 Cell, 280Ah Lithium Iron Phosphate Battery

3.2 v lifepo4 280ah is prismatic lithium iron phosphate battery. LFP71173200-280Ah is the upgrade product of LFP54173200-205Ah and energy density of LFP71173200-280Ah can reach 170Wh/kg. This product has been widely applied for industrial vehicles and commercial vehicles such as buses, UPS, trucks and forklifts etcetera.

750 LFP DC Block

Manufactured by KORE Power for medium to long duration storage applications, the K 2 280 Lithium Iron Phosphate battery cell delivers top tier energy density in a durable prismatic form factor. ‍ Capacity. 280 Ah. Energy. 896 Wh. Energy Density. 179 Wh/kg. Voltage. 3.2 V. P2 750 Storage Rack. Designed and assembled by KORE Power, the P2 storage rack is engineered

Detailed Breakdown of the Cost Composition of 280Ah Energy Storage

According to SMM''s calculations, the current theoretical cost of the 280Ah lithium iron phosphate energy storage cell (hereinafter referred to as the 280 energy storage cell) is about 0.34 yuan/Wh, which is the same as last week on a week-on-week basis. How are lithium ion phosphate battery cells made?

Lithium-ion Phosphate battery cells, including the 280Ah variant, undergo a meticulous manufacturing process. This typically begins with the preparation of cathode and anode materials. For LiFePO4 cells, lithium iron phosphate is utilized as the cathode material due to its stability and safety.
